Hokkaido dairy farm : change, otherness and the search for security

Hokkaido has been essential to Japan's modern nation-state building project. The region's importance was initially promoted through a polysemic quest for macro security; to secure, or fix, the northern island into the structure of modem Japan and in-so-doing to provide safety or security....
